Green roofs, often referred to as living roofs, are layered systems installed on building rooftops to support vegetation. They can vary from extensive systems, which have shallow soil substrates and require little maintenance, to intensive systems, featuring deeper soil profiles and a wider variety of plants. Green roofs offer numerous benefits, including improved insulation, reduced urban heat island effect, enhanced air quality, and increased biodiversity within urban settings. By absorbing rainwater, green roofs also mitigate stormwater runoff, reducing the strain on municipal drainage systems.

On May 16, 2024, the District Court of The Hague, the Netherlands, issued the judgment result of Maxeon's application for an interim injunction against Aiko shares. The court held that Aiko's related ABC products did not infringe Maxeon EP2297788B1 patent and denied the application for an interim injunction.

Monofacial solar panels are the traditional solar panels that most people are familiar with. They consist of a single layer of solar cells mounted on a backing material, usually glass. These panels capture sunlight on one side, converting it into electricity through photovoltaic (PV) technology. Monofacial panels have been widely used for years due to their reliability, efficiency, and availability. Typically, they offer an efficiency rating between 15% and 22%, depending on the technology and manufacturer.

Today, PV cells account for a significant portion of the global renewable energy landscape. According to the International Energy Agency (IEA), solar PV capacity reached over 900 gigawatts (GW) by 2020, making it one of the fastest-growing energy sources worldwide. The increasing affordability of solar technology has made it accessible to consumers and businesses alike, with costs dropping by more than 80% since 2010.
